About Electrotherm (India) Ltd

  • Electrotherm (India) Limited (EIL), incorporated in October, 1986, is a leading engineering company, known for providing best steel melting equipment globally.
  • The Company has significant presence in steel sector for TMT Bar and DI Pipe industry in India.
  • The Company is engaged in the business of manufacturing induction furnaces, TMT Bars, Ductile Iron Pipes (DI Pipes), Electric Vehicles, Transformers etc. EIL is manufacturing induction melting furnaces, TMT Bars, Ductile Iron Pipes (DI Pipes), Electric Vehicles, Transformers, Transmission Line Towers etc.
  • EIL is also into wind power generation.
  • Since its first order of 350-KW Medium frequency induction furnace in Jun 1983, it has installed over 300 induction furnaces allover India and abroad sofar.

About Surani Steel Tubes Ltd

  • Surani Steel Tubes Limited was originally incorporated as a Private Limited Company with the name 'Surani Steel Private Limited' on July 31, 2012.
  • Further, the name of the Company changed to 'Surani Steel Tubes Private Limited' on August 13, 2018.
  • Subsequently, the Company was converted into a Public Limited Company and the name was changed to Surani Steel Tubes Limited on September 12, 2018. Surani Steel's modernized and state of the art production facility is based at Gujarat.
  • The Company is having presence in Commercial, Structural and Engineering Sector with wider range of ERW Pipes.
  • It carries out a Quality Management System certified in accordance with well maintained UT Machine, Hydro testing Machine and many other types of equipment in its premises which checks from, Raw material to Finished Goods.
